Founded in 1937, First New York is a full-service, not-for-profit financial cooperative that provides personal and business banking to consumers and businesses in the Capital Region. First New York offers complete financial services, including checking and savings accounts, auto and home loans, credit cards, online and mobile banking, business services, and commercial and investment services. The Credit Union currently has $493 million in assets. It serves over 37,000+ members with full-service branches in Albany, Cobleskill, Glenville, Halfmoon, Niskayuna, North Greenbush, Rotterdam, and Saratoga, and scholastic branches in Schenectady, Burnt Hills-Ballston Lake and Mohonasen High Schools. Members can access 5,600+ shared branch locations and 30,000+ fee-free ITM/ATMs nationwide.
